Customer Review: Great addition to my Leatherman New Wave - useful and compact.
Summary: 5 Stars

I'm quite a fan of the modified Leatherman bits. They have come in handy more often than I thought they might. In fact, just the other day I found myself changing a taillight (in the freezing cold) on the truck with these.

The kit isn't cheap, but you are paying for the formfactor and convenience. There is another Wave add-on which allows you to use standard driver bits, but it's quite a bit larger than this system.

To start, they've shaved off about 2/5ths to 1/2 of the thickness of a standard bit. This allows them to configure a driver slot in with other tools without taking up the entire Multitool handle for a screwdriver. This kit comes with a nice nylon sheath, but I've found that to be a little too much for me personally. The configuration contains 2 hard plastic holsters for all of the bits. They even include a spare eyeglass driver.

I've changed up my every day carry to include the most commonly used bits on one of the two plastic "cards". I put this 1 card into the back pocket of my New Wave nylon sheath (I've heard of others doing this on their leather sheath, but I don't think there's enough room, personally.

So I don't really use the included sheath with both toolbit cards in it. I just move them around until I get the desired mix and carry one card with my Wave in one sheath. A very nice way to do it, and Leatherman obviously had this in mind when making the cards.

The only real detractor is that the sheath that comes with these isn't really fitted perfectly, but after some use, it probably would be better. I just didn't give it a chance.

The cost is a little high, but the steel is very high quality and I haven't noticed any stripping or spinning out yet. I wish it was cheaper, but this means I don't have to carry a large and heavy pack of bits and I'm willing to pay for that convenience.

Customer Review: Great for almost anything
Summary: 4 Stars

I love multitools and if you travel around this is a perfect accessory to a Leatherman multitool (as long as you have the right model).

+Durable bits
+Easy to store
+Great organizer
+25 year limited warranty

-Some bits are all but useless

I severed six years active duty in the Marine Corps with the first three years as a Radio Repairman and a Leahterman multitool replaced nearly 70% of my tool kit that I was required to have. Then as I got out and started to travel more in Europe, Middle East and Africa that's when I noticed I started to use more and more of these bits. I was working as a handyman in France and that's when I really started to used the hexagonal bits. The best part what that these bits fit in the nylon sheath I had for my Leahterman without interfering pulling the multitool out.


The only thing that I would want with this item, and this is not a knock against the item itself, but it would be smart to include the the bit extension. Again that's more of marketing thing pertaining to Leatherman.
